I did appreciate the way the author balanced Rin’s character development; even though she becomes more and more morally grey and winds up committing terrible atrocities in war, somehow I still cared about her. If anything, the trajectory of becoming both more powerful and more traumatized made her a more compelling character. I didn’t always like her, but I am invested.

I would have liked more exploration of character relationships, especially concerning the events of Part III. There was such a sudden tonal shift, perhaps to reflect the realities of war, but I felt like there should have been an appropriate reflection of Rin's investment in the relationships she's held throughout the book. Though her dilemmas are the main focus of the story, as the heroine, it would have made it more heartbreaking to see more of our other side characters, particularly those she spent time with in the academy. Though I surmise we will learn more from them in the succeeding novels, which I hear are even better than this.
Overall, a highly recommended book for anyone with the stomach and will to see it through. Be sure to heed the trigger warnings before you dive into the lands of Nikara.
